1. The Outer Banks: Sun, Sand, and Seclusion

Just a short drive from Elizabeth City, the Outer Banks is one of the most sought-after romantic destinations in North Carolina. With its pristine beaches, unique lighthouses, and laid-back atmosphere, it’s the perfect spot for couples looking to relax by the sea.

  • Nags Head: Spend a day strolling along the beach or enjoy a sunset picnic at Jockey’s Ridge State Park, home to the tallest natural sand dune on the East Coast. Afterward, indulge in a cozy dinner at one of the waterfront restaurants overlooking the sound.

  • Hatteras Island: If you're looking for something more secluded, head to Hatteras Island. Known for its stunning, quiet beaches, it’s the perfect place to unwind, take long walks, or enjoy a peaceful evening together gazing at the stars.

  • Ocracoke Island: For a more off-the-beaten-path experience, take a ferry to Ocracoke Island. This quiet, charming island is known for its peaceful atmosphere and scenic beauty. Explore the quaint shops, dine at local seafood restaurants, or relax by the water.

3. Whale Head Club: A Historical and Scenic Hideaway

A short drive from Elizabeth City, Whale Head Club in Corolla, NC, offers a romantic, historic experience for couples. This stately 1920s estate is nestled among natural beauty, offering stunning views of the Currituck Sound.

  • Historic Tours: Take a tour of this beautifully restored mansion and learn about its rich history. The serene setting and grand architecture make it an ideal spot for couples who appreciate history and culture.

  • Picnic by the Sound: After the tour, pack a picnic and relax by the water. The views from Whale Head Club are breathtaking, and the peaceful environment makes it a perfect place to spend quality time with your loved one.


4. Dismal Swamp State Park: Nature Lovers' Paradise

For couples who love nature and outdoor activities, Dismal Swamp State Park offers a unique, serene setting just outside Elizabeth City. Whether you want to hike, bike, or take a peaceful boat ride through the swamp, this park has it all.

  • Hiking & Birdwatching: Take a hike along the park’s trails, where you can spot local wildlife and enjoy the tranquility of the swamp. The Boardwalk Trail is especially beautiful and perfect for couples looking to experience nature together.

  • Paddle Through the Swamp: Rent a kayak or canoe for a romantic boat ride through the swamp’s quiet waters. Paddle together through the peaceful surroundings and experience the natural beauty up close.
